How do I get more views on Instagram Reels?

Reels reach is decided by how a small test audience behaves in the first minutes — watch-through rate, replays, shares and saves. Instagram shows the Reel to a small group, measures those signals, then either expands distribution or stops. Early engagement is therefore worth far more than late engagement.

Why do early views matter so much?

Because they feed the test. A Reel that sits at zero for an hour rarely recovers — not because it was judged bad, but because it was never sampled widely enough to be judged at all. Getting past that cold start is the specific problem view services solve.

What no service can do

Hold attention. If viewers leave in three seconds, extra views simply prove the point faster. Fix the first three seconds and the distribution takes care of itself.
